Global Brain Monitoring Market Industry Market Size, Share Outlook, Growth Analysis Report and Forecast Trends 2026-2030

The global brain monitoring market encompasses medical devices and technologies used to measure brain activity, including conditions like stroke, traumatic brain injury, sleep disorders, and neurodegenerative diseases. Valued at approximately $6.9 billion in 2025, the market is projected to grow at a compound annual rate of around 6.9%, driven by aging populations, rising neurological disorder prevalence, and technological advancements in wearable and non-invasive monitoring solutions. Key product categories include electroencephalography (EEG) systems, magnetoencephalography (MEG) devices, intracranial pressure monitors, and cerebral oximeters, with increasing adoption in both hospital and home care settings.

Market Overview

The global brain monitoring market includes medical devices designed to record, analyze, and interpret brain activity for diagnostic and therapeutic purposes. The market encompasses technologies such as electroencephalography, magnetoencephalography, transcranial Doppler, and cerebral oximetry, serving applications across hospitals, diagnostic centers, ambulatory surgical centers, and home care settings.

  • Market valued at approximately $6.9 billion in 2025 with projected CAGR of 6.9% through the early 2030s
  • Primary applications include diagnosis and monitoring of epilepsy, stroke, traumatic brain injury, sleep disorders, and neurodegenerative conditions
  • Product segments include devices (monitors, electrodes, sensors) and accessories used in clinical and research environments

Growth Drivers

The market is propelled by several interconnected factors. Aging demographics in developed and developing nations have increased the incidence of age-related neurological disorders requiring continuous monitoring. Additionally, growing awareness of mental health conditions, rising traumatic brain injury cases from sports and accidents, and the proliferation of wearable brain-computer interface technologies are expanding demand. Advances in miniaturization, wireless connectivity, and AI-powered signal analysis are making devices more accessible and clinically valuable.

  • Rising global prevalence of neurological disorders such as epilepsy, dementia, and Parkinson's disease
  • Technological innovations enabling portable, wireless, and AI-enhanced monitoring devices for continuous use
  • Increasing healthcare expenditure and favorable reimbursement policies for neurological diagnostics in major markets

Segmentation and Regional Analysis

The market is segmented by product type, including EEG systems, MEG devices, intracranial pressure monitors, cerebral oximeters, and Doppler devices. Disease-based segmentation covers stroke, traumatic brain injury, sleep disorders, epilepsy, and headache disorders. Geographically, North America holds the largest market share due to advanced healthcare infrastructure, followed by Europe, while Asia-Pacific is expected to grow fastest driven by improving healthcare access and rising disposable incomes in countries like China, India, and Japan.

  • North America leads in market share, with Europe second; Asia-Pacific represents the fastest-growing regional segment
  • Electroencephalography remains the dominant technology segment, while wearable and ambulatory monitoring technologies are gaining share
  • Hospital end-users currently dominate, though home-based monitoring is an emerging growth segment

Trends and Outlook

What are the recent trends and outlook?

Several emerging trends are shaping the future trajectory of the brain monitoring market. Integration of artificial intelligence and machine learning for automated signal interpretation is improving diagnostic accuracy and reducing clinician workload. Miniaturization and wearable sensor technologies are enabling continuous ambulatory monitoring outside clinical settings. Additionally, the convergence of brain monitoring with neurostimulation and closed-loop therapeutic systems represents a significant frontier for personalized neurology. Over the next five years, the market is expected to reach substantially higher valuations as these innovations mature and adoption expands globally.

  • AI and machine learning algorithms are increasingly embedded in devices for real-time seizure detection and trend analysis
  • Wearable and consumer-grade brain monitoring devices are bridging clinical and wellness markets
  • Telemedicine and remote patient monitoring post-pandemic are accelerating demand for home-based brain monitoring solutions
